| Wonderful, it was an amazing evening! The show was fantastic, a great mix of old and new ("...In what is fast becoming a tradition for the evening, this one's a new song...") and the new songs off Moolah Rouge blended brilliantly with the old favourites. I loved Moolah Rouge from the start, but know some people didn't, but have also heard people say that seeing the songs live got them into it - I can understand that (dare I say it  , I had a similar experience with SSK, I didn't *truly* deeply connect with a lot of it until I'd seen them live). They were obviously loving being back home in Manchester and it was a good atmosphere, although a bit too much gassing and not enough listening in the audience at times (and it got commented on!  ) Johnny did a couple of gorgeous solo spots (Astray, No Fear of Falling) while the others popped out for a fag  and at the other end of the spectrum there were more than a couple where they really rocked, includig my favourite off the new album, Suddenly Strange, and of course Life in a Day. Finishing off with I Believe, a great evening. And I've just heard on another thread that they're supporting at Delamere.
